Commodity series: Rat woman
It is a small terrestrial animal. It likes moist and dark environments under rocks, rotten wood, places rich in humus, or in tree holes, moist grass and moss. It is omnivorous and feeds on decaying organic matter such as decaying plants, dead wood, moss, lichens, bark, green leaves, dead grass, and fungal spores. They can simply be raised in a breeding box covered with moist leaf mold and are commonly used cleaning organisms that can help degrade dead plants, animal feces and food residues.
